About Gummy Dolphins

Gummy Dolphins is what happens when you want cyan's brightness without its nervous energy. It's saturated enough to land, but it's got warmth running underneath that keeps it from feeling sterile. This is the blue-green that actually looks intentional on screen instead of like you settled for something in between.

Use it in health dashboards, fintech platforms, and product interfaces where you need a primary accent that feels approachable without being diluted. Active buttons, key data highlights, prominent links, the kind of UI work that needs to pull attention without demanding it. It sits warmer than (which knows its job is support) and brighter than (which leans into gravitas). Gummy Dolphins just works harder without the attitude.

On cooler monitors it'll stay clean and readable. On warmer displays it might drift slightly teal, which honestly just softens the mood. The real thing to watch: test it early against your actual backgrounds and text colors. This one's specific enough that pairing makes all the difference.

Contrast checker

WCAG 2.1 contrast ratios.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text, 3:1 for large. AAA requires 7:1 / 4.5:1.

On White #ffffff

Aa
2.79:1Fail

On Gray 100 #f5f5f5

Aa
2.56:1Fail

On Gray 900 #18181b

Aa
6.36:1AAAAA Large

On Black #000000

Aa
7.54:1AAA
